In a world buzzing with economic activities, three vibrant cities stand out for their unique business environments: Tel Aviv in Israel, Indonesia with its evolving business regulations, and Sao Paulo in Brazil. Let's take a closer look at what sets these cities apart and makes them hotspots for entrepreneurs and businesses alike. **Tel Aviv, Israel: The Start-Up Nation** Tel Aviv has earned its reputation as the "Start-Up Nation" due to its thriving tech scene and innovative ecosystem. The city is home to thousands of start-ups, tech companies, and venture capital firms, making it a hub for cutting-edge technology and entrepreneurship. With a culture that celebrates risk-taking and innovation, Tel Aviv attracts top talent from around the world, driving creativity and growth in various industries. Furthermore, Tel Aviv's strategic location provides easy access to international markets, making it an ideal base for companies looking to expand globally. The city's vibrant nightlife, beautiful beaches, and rich cultural heritage also make it a desirable place to live and work, further enhancing its appeal to entrepreneurs and professionals. **Indonesia Business Regulation: Navigating a Complex Landscape** Indonesia, Southeast Asia's largest economy, offers tremendous business opportunities but also comes with its fair share of regulatory challenges. Navigating Indonesia's business regulations requires careful attention to detail and a deep understanding of the local legal framework. From company registration and licensing to tax compliance and employment laws, businesses operating in Indonesia must adhere to a complex set of rules and regulations. Despite the challenges, Indonesia remains an attractive market for foreign investors due to its large consumer base, growing middle class, and strategic location in the region. With a rapidly evolving business environment and ongoing efforts to streamline regulations, Indonesia continues to be a promising destination for businesses looking to tap into the country's vast potential. **Sao Paulo, Brazil: The Economic Powerhouse of South America** Sao Paulo, Brazil's largest city and financial hub, plays a crucial role in driving the country's economy forward. With a diverse economy spanning industries such as finance, manufacturing, agriculture, and technology, Sao Paulo offers a wealth of opportunities for businesses to thrive and expand. Despite facing challenges such as bureaucracy, high taxes, and economic volatility, Sao Paulo remains a key player in South America's economic landscape. The city's entrepreneurial spirit, dynamic business environment, and skilled workforce attract both domestic and foreign investors looking to capitalize on Brazil's vast market potential. In conclusion, Tel Aviv, Israel, Indonesia, and Sao Paulo, Brazil, each offer unique opportunities and challenges for businesses operating in their respective markets.
